compact discs are made of polycarbonate plastic followed by a thin layer of aluminum coating over the polycarbonate plastic then finished with a clear protective acrylic coating over the aluminum layer
some companies use silver or gold instead of the aluminum layer

Compact discs are made from polycarbonate which is one form of thermoplastic. Consider thermoplastic is a superset which contains various forms of polymers and polycarbonate is just one of them. So the statement compact disc is made from thermoplastic is true. But to be more specific compact disc is made from polycarbonate.Refer to the article on for more detail on the material used in making compact discs.
They don't. Magnets have no impact on compact discs, since they don't work by magnetism.
Compact discs became widely available on the market in 1983, though they actually were first put into production in 1982.
